Reasons for Procedure
You may need to be treated by having a splenectomy if you have:
- Trauma to the spleen
- Spleen rupture due to tumor, infection, inflammatory condition, or medicines
- Enlargement of the spleen (splenomegaly)
- Certain blood disorders
- Myelofibrosis (abnormal formation of fibrous tissue in the bone marrow)
- Damage in the blood vessels of the spleen
- Leukemia or lymphoma
- Diseased spleen, due to disorders like HIV infection
- Tumor or abscess in the spleen
- Liver disease
